Where to Use This Design with Caution
While the Alligator Mom Gator Girl Zookeeper embroidery design is versatile, there are some limitations to be aware of:
- Small hoop sizes: May require resizing or omitting elements if hoop space is tight.
- Stretchy or thin fabric: The satin-stitched outlines may pucker on soft knits or sheer materials without proper stabilizer.
- Dark fabric backgrounds: Thread color contrast becomes critical. Light-colored thread on black fabric may not pop as expected.
- Detailed corners: Watch for thread breaks or distortion in the smaller facial features if stitching on textured or uneven surfaces.
Stitch Clarity and Fabric Choice Matter
In my test runs, the stitch density felt appropriate for most mid-weight cottons and canvas materials. The fill stitches were clean and didn't bleed into outlines, which is important for keeping the characters looking intentional. However, on a stretchy cotton jersey, I noticed slight distortion in the eyes and mouth unless I used a lightweight cutaway stabilizer.

Commercial Use and Licensing Considerations
As with any digital embroidery file, it's important to verify the licensing terms included with the Alligator Mom Gator Girl Zookeeper SVG file. If you're selling finished items or digital bundles, make sure the license allows for commercial use. Many SVG files for Cricut or Silhouette are limited to personal use unless upgraded.
Practical Notes for Embroidery Designers
Before stitching this design into your next product, consider these steps:
- Test the design on scrap fabric first, especially if using a new stabilizer or thread type.
- Check thread color contrast on both light and dark fabric backgrounds.
- Review stitch density to avoid puckering or fabric distortion.
- Confirm hoop size compatibility with your embroidery machine.
- Inspect small facial details for clarity, especially if resizing.
- Try a black and white mockup to evaluate contrast and overall composition.
- Use a quality lightweight or medium-weight stabilizer for best results.
- Confirm whether the design works for both personal and commercial projects.
